Yael Zerubavel

  • Yael Zerubavel
  • Zerubavel, Yael
  • Professor Emerita of Jewish Studies and History
  • Schools: Ph.D. University of Pennsylvania, M.A. University of Pennsylvania, B.A. Tel-Aviv University
  • Email Address: This email address is being protected from spambots. You need JavaScript enabled to view it.

Founding Director

The Allen and Joan Bildner Center for the Study of Jewish Life

RESEARCH INTERESTS

  • Nationalism, national myths 
  • Israeli culture, Israeli literature, Israeli film
  • Jewish memory, Jewish space
  • Trauma and identity

COURSES TAUGHT

  • Israeli Culture
  • Cultural Memory
  • Jewish Immigrant Experience
  • Jewish Memory
    Jewish Space
  • Trauma and Memory in Israeli Culture
  • Israeli Society through Film

 

PUBLICATIONS

Image COMPLETE LIST OF PUBLICATIONS

Books

Desert, Island, Wall: Symbolic Landscapes the Politics of Space in Israeli Culture Desert, Island, Wall: Symbolic Landscapes the Politics of Space in Israeli Culture

Ben-Gurion Institute for the Study of Israel and Zionism, and Shazar Center for Jewish History (Hebrew), 2023

Tel Hai, 1920-2020: History and Memory Tel Hai, 1920-2020: History and Memory

Yad Yitzhak Ben-Zvi & Tel Aviv University Press, 2020

Desert in the Promised Land Desert in the Promised Land

Stanford University Press, 2019

Recovered Roots: Collective Memory and the Making of Israeli National Tradition Recovered Roots: Collective Memory and the Making of Israeli National Tradition

University of Chicago Press, 1995

Recent Articles (Selected)

"Zikaron ve-shikheha ba-hevra ha-yisra’elit” [Memory and Forgetting in Israeli Society]: an introductory essay, in Zikaron, hafatsim ve-yitsugim [Memory, Artefacts and Representations], edited by Naama Sheffi and Edna Lomsky-Feder. Haifa: Pardes Publishing, 2023, 29-43.

 

"Identity (Ex)Changes, Gender, and Family Ties: Cinematic Representations of Israeli Jews and Palestinians,” in Reel Gender: Palestinian and Israeli Cinema, edited by Sa’ed Atshan and Katharina Galor, Bloomsbury Publishing, 2022, 197-229

“My Life as a Dialogue: An Autobiographical Essay” [Ha’hayim be’dialog: Masa otobiographit] in Kavin li’demutenu, edited by Avner Ben-Amos and Ofer Shiff, Ben-Gurion Institute for the Study of Israel and Zionism, Ben-Gurion University & Yediot Ahronot, 2020 (Hebrew).

“The Shepherd, the Well, and the Jug: National Memory and Symbolic Bridges to Antiquity in Modern Hebrew Culture", in Contexts of Folklore: Festschrift for Dan Ben-Amos, edited by Simon J. Bronner and Wolfgang Mieder. Peter Lang Publishers: 2019, 333-42.

“Negotiating Difference and Empathy: Cinematic Representations of Passing and Exchanged Identities in the Israeli-Palestinian Conflict,” in Rethinking Peace: Discourse, Memory, Translation and Dialogue, edited by Alexander Laban Hinton, Gorgio Shari and Jeremiah Alberg. New York: Rowman and Littlefield, 2019, 93-107.

“Putting Numbers into Space: Place Names and Collective Remembrance in Israeli Culture,” in Taking Stock: Cultures of Enumeration in Contemporary Jewish Life, edited by Michal Kravel-Tovi and Deborah Dash Moore. Bloomington: Indiana University Press, 2016, 69-92

“’Numerical Commemoration and the Challenges of Collective Remembrance in Israel,” History and Memory 26, 1 (Spring/Summer 2014): 5-38.
Hebrew version: “Hantsaha misparit ve-shiyum he-avar: zikaron ve-shikhekha ba-merhav ha-tziburi be’israel,” in Majority-Minority Relations: Memory and Oblivion in Geographical Place Names, eds. Amer Dahamshe and Yossi Schwartz. Tel Aviv: Resling (191-223)

"Passages, Wars, and Encounters with Death: The Desert as a Site of Memory in Israeli Film,” in Deeper than Oblivion: Trauma and Memory in Israeli Cinema, edited by Raz Yosef and Boaz Hagin. New York & London: Bloomsbury, 2013, 299-327.

“Ha’tanakh akhshav: Ikh’shuv, satira politit ve’zikaron le’umi” [“'The Bible Now': Contemporizing, Political Satire, and National Memory”], a combined issue of Jerusalem Studies in Jewish Folklore vol. 28 and Jerusalem Studies in Hebrew Literature vol. 25 in honor of Galit Hasan-Rokem, (2013), II, 755-74 [in Hebrew].

“Transforming Myths, Contested Narratives: The Reshaping of Mnemonic Traditions in Israeli Culture,” in National Myths: Constructed Pasts, Contested Presents, edited by Gérard Bouchard. London: Routledge, 2013, 173-90.

“Ha’hazara el ha’tanakh:Ha’tiyul ve’zikhron ha’avar ba’siah ha’tayaruti be’israel [“Back to the Bible: Hiking in the Land as a Mnemonic Practice in Contemporary Israeli Tourist Discourse”], in History and Memory: Essays in Honor of Anita Shapira, edited by Meir Hazan and Uri Cohen. Jerusalem: Zalman Shazar Center for Jewish History, 2012, vol. 2, 497- 522 [in Hebrew].

“Coping with the Legacy of Death: The War Widow in Israeli Films,” in Israeli Cinema: Identities in Motion, edited by Miri Talmon and Yaron Peleg. Austin: University of Texas Press, 2011, 84-95.

 

HONORS AND FELLOWSHIPS

Lifetime Achievement Award, Association for Israel Studies, 2019
Frankel Institute for Advanced Judaic Studies, University of Michigan, Ann Arbor, Fall 2016
Katz Center for Advanced Judaic Studies, University of Pennsylvania, 1994-95, 2009-10
Ben-Gurion Research Center at Ben-Gurion University, Israel, Spring 2005 (visiting fellow)
Institute for Advanced Studies, the Hebrew University, Jerusalem, Spring 2004
Center for the Critical Analysis of Contemporary Culture at Rutgers, 2001-2
École Pratique des Hautes Études, Paris, Spring 2000 (visiting fellow)
The 1996 Salo Baron Prize of the American Academy for Jewish Research
